Ethereum developers have formally proposed EIP-8182 for inclusion in the upcoming Hegota hard fork, marking a significant step in the network’s ongoing development.
The proposal aims to introduce optional native privacy transfers directly at the Ethereum Layer 1 protocol. If adopted, the feature could provide users with a built-in privacy mechanism without relying entirely on external applications or services.
Ethereum EIP-8182 Enters Hard Fork Review Process
Developer Tom Lehman announced that EIP-8182 has been formally proposed for inclusion in the Hegota hard fork. The proposal has entered the Proposal for Inclusion (PFI) stage, where Ethereum core developers evaluate its suitability for a future network upgrade. This stage is an important milestone in the Ethereum Improvement Proposal process.
The proposal is now under consideration alongside several other upgrades planned for the Hegota hard fork. Inclusion is not guaranteed, as developers must assess technical feasibility, security implications, and network impact. The review process allows the community and developers to discuss potential benefits and risks before implementation.

Native Privacy Transfers on Ethereum
EIP-8182 seeks to introduce optional privacy transfers directly within the ETH protocol. Unlike external privacy solutions, the feature would operate at the Layer 1 level, making privacy functionality part of the network’s core infrastructure. Users would have the choice to utilize privacy transfers without affecting standard transaction functionality.
The proposal also aims to provide these privacy features without requiring additional protocol fees. By integrating privacy capabilities into ETH itself, developers hope to improve accessibility and usability for users who require enhanced transaction confidentiality. The optional nature of the proposal is intended to preserve flexibility across different use cases.
